325N.11 CONTRACT REQUIREMENT; FORM AND LANGUAGE.
A foreclosure purchaser shall enter into every foreclosure reconveyance in the form of a written contract. Every contract must be written in letters of a size equal to at least 12-point boldface type, in the same language principally used by the foreclosure purchaser and foreclosed homeowner to negotiate the sale of the residence in foreclosure and must be fully completed and signed and dated by the foreclosed homeowner and foreclosure purchaser before the execution of any instrument of conveyance of the residence in foreclosure.
